How much does a Westcore Properties Inc Assistant Controller make?

25% $140,866 10% $124,711 90% $194,869 75% $177,645 $158,717 50%(Median)

As of August 2026, the average salary for Assistant Controller at Westcore Properties Inc in the United States is $158,717 per year, which is equivalent to an hourly rate of approximately $76. Most salaries for this position fall within the range of $140,866 to $177,645 annually.

The exact salary offered will depend on factors such as a candidate's years of experience, skills, department and location.

About Westcore Properties Inc
Westcore Properties is a global, entrepreneurial commercial real estate investment firm with a specialized focus in Western United States commercial and industrial properties.
